Description

Really nice place. It's an orquids ecological reserve where they have hundreds of diferent types, most of them miniatures. The entrance is 30 quetzales per person and includes a guided tour, a documentary about their work and a tea from a local cooperative. They Also have a couple of cabañas but We don't know the price. The owner is a Kombi lover very friendly who gave us some help about what was going on with a wierd noise on our westy. Totaly recomended.

Beautiful campground in the middle of an orchids forest. Extremely friendly and helpful staff. Definitely one of the nicest campings we've been to in Central America.

Good option to spend the night when in Cobán. Showers were working when we stayed and warm but only a drizzle came out, so don’t expect too much. Power outlet in bathroom was not working but there are 2 more next to the kitchen sink. Everything was clean. Driveway definitely manageable for normal vehicles and vans, also when wet. We didn’t do the tour as it was pouring all evening and the next morning.

The black dog living on the property was a bit too clingy, tried to jump in to our car all the time and wouldn’t let us cook or eat in peace.

beautiful campsite really. the showers did not work when we camped there but they were working on fixing that, they are electric showers. the cafe is an outdoor area in the rainforest, quite beautiful really! we worked there with our computers for a day, average wifi. we walked around the orchid forest but not many to see. didn't take the tour. the camp price was 40pp, with discount to 20pp if you take the orchid tour for 50pp (only in Spanish). the driveway to get to the campground is quite steep especially when wet, we struggle coming up in our 2wd sprinter van..

Really nice and well kept place in a beautiful natural setting. Very interesting guided tour (now also in English!) through a small forest with hundreds of different orchids. Still Q50 pp for the tour and Q20 pppn for camping (Q40 pp if you don’t book the tour).

Lovely campsite. We paid 50Qpp for the orchid tour plus 20Qpp to camp (total 140Q for 2 people). Tour is very worthwhile IF your Spanish is good enough to understand the info. The guide told us lots of fascinating stuff and we really enjoyed it, BUT if you don't understand all this, it's just a walk pointing at some pretty flowers. Some of the flowers are so tiny you would not spot them without the guide explaining.
Nice coffee, tea and chocolate in the little cafe, but that is all they have there - no food or other drinks.
